INSTALLATION GUIDE
This appliance can be installed as a built-in unit only. The
clearances shown in the below drawing must be fol-
lowed.
Avoid damaging the product during installation, position-
ing of the appliance requires two people to avoid injuries
or damage to the appliance.
Your appliance should not be located in direct sunlight or
exposed to continuous heat or extreme temperature
(e.g., next to a radiator or boiler). If this is not feasible,
then you should install an insulation plate between the
appliance and the adjacent heat source.
You should check whether there is an electrical socket
available, which will be accessible after your appliance is
installed.
Place the appliance flat and firmly on a solid base.
Be sure to leave enough space for the opening of the
door to avoid damage to the appliance or personal injury.
The cabinet size must be a minimum of (H)1223 x (W)560
x (D)550mm. The cabinet must have a ventilation recess
of (W)540 x (D)50mm.
The cabinet must not be enclosed. The back wooden
panel of the cabinet must either be removed completely
or cut out. This allows sufficient air circulation to cool
down the condenser unit for energy efficiency.
CHANGE THE OPENING DIRECTION
OF YOUR PRODUCT
To reverse the door you will need to tilt the appliance back-
ward to access the lower hinge which holds screws. Do not tilt
the appliance more than 45 degrees and do not lay the appli-
ance flat on its side.
For your own safety, a minimum of 2 people should lift or tilt
this product.
Tools Required: Torx headed screwdriver, flat headed screw-
driver and hexagonal spanner or a socket driver.
1.
Unscrew the 2 screws from the upper hinge and re-
move the fridge door by carefully lifting it up and
away from the appliance. Do not fix the hinge to the
opposite side.
2.
Unscrew the 2 screws from the lower hinge and re-
move the hinge. Do not fix the hinge to the opposite
side at this stage.
3.
Remove all of the screw cap covers on the opposite
side of the appliance from where the hinges have
just been removed. Remove the hinge plugs on the
top and bottom of the door and fix them to the op-
posite side.
4.
Flip over the upper hinge 180° (so the pin is pointing
upwards) and fix on to the opposite side at the bot-
tom of the appliance. Place the door back on to the
lower hinge.
